I heart Matt and Blair. They have been such a treat to work with and are just the sweetest pair. Their wedding day was full of personal stylish details and people who adore them. A neighborhood little girl even blew bubbles for them. They chose Housing Works Bookstore for their reception where all proceeds go toward a non-profit organization. Matt’s mother illustrated book themes from their favorite childhood books in place of table numbers and library cards filled in for seating assignment.
